Tonight, Shawn and I—one of our coaches—are heading up to the Northeast where we've been invited to speak and present to a group of contractors in Providence, Rhode Island at the JLC LIVE convention. We're super excited about it. When we attend trade shows and talk to contractors—or really, any other business owners—we hear a common refrain: "Nobody wants to work anymore." As we listen to the complaints, we can't help but smirk a little bit. It's easy to blame Millennials or Gen Zers, but is that really the root of the problem? Is that why we can't build a loyal crew or retain the top talent we've been looking for—let alone even find it? Recently, I received an email with a subject line that said this—I’m not making this up: "Jason quit. This sucks. I'm hating Millennials." While it’s tempting to point fingers at younger generations, the reality is a little more complex than that. It’s not that people don’t want to work—it’s that they don’t want to work in chaotic environments that lack clarity and direction.
